Contemporary history meets art

Dr. Alexander Kraus talks about Wolfsburg's cultural policy

On the first Thursday of every month, Marcus Körber, director of the Städtische Galerie Wolfsburg, invites visitors to an art talk during the lunch break. To mark the 50th anniversary of the Städtische Galerie, he holds talks with people from Wolfsburg and the region about the current exhibitions. The topics covered will include the city's history, art and culture as well as current world events. After visiting the exhibition, lunch can be enjoyed together in the hunting hall of Wolfsburg Castle.

Dr. Alexander Kraus from the Institute for Contemporary History and City Presentation (IZS) will be our guest on 08.05.2025. In keeping with the anniversary of the Städtische Galerie Wolfsburg, Körber and Kraus will discuss key aspects of Wolfsburg's cultural policy in a historical and current context, with the current anniversary exhibition builds a bridge between the past and the present. The various historical documents on display from the IZS archive give visitors an insight into the city's early cultural policy decisions. In addition, they address the handling of art in public spaces in Wolfsburg.
